What is a cookie?

It is a file that is downloaded to your computer or other device when accessing certain web pages that collects information about your navigation on that website. In some cases, cookies are necessary to facilitate navigation and allow you to store and retrieve information about the browsing habits of a user or the equipment, among other things and, according to the information they contain and the way they use the equipment, they can be used to recognize the user.

MoodleSession*

Technical Cookie.

The Virtual Platform could not be accessed, since it would not recognize either the User or their Password. You must allow your browser to accept it in order to keep the service running from one page to another. When you leave the platform or close your browser, the 'cookie' is destroyed (in your browser and on the server).

At the end of the navigation session

MOODLEID*

Technical Cookie.

It is limited to remembering your username within the browser. This means that when you return to the site, your name will automatically be entered in the username (userid) field. If you want more security, do not use this option: you will only have to type your name manually each time you want to enter.

At the end of the navigation session.
